Transaction 8c3007c9738aa34869f2f6be90fb5cebe4b785acb435ce359e3e4ed21c9e8c7f
1 Input
1 Output
-
8c3007c9738aa34869f2f6be90fb5cebe4b785acb435ce359e3e4ed21c9e8c7f:0
- value
- 18284864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a44ac25b15a56ad5a783e8877aa550ff67a136c0 OP_EQUAL
- address
- 3GfiJN63SVBJnpUVUjGf8W2hwXdDkXcTdU